professional work · 2007–2019

Wedding Photography.

For over a decade I worked as a professional wedding photographer, first as a second shooter (with Cape Breton's John Ratchford), learning the craft under pressure, then building my own clientele across Nova Scotia and beyond. It was some of the most demanding and rewarding work I have ever done.

Weddings are unscripted. You have one chance at every moment — the first look, the father’s face, the quiet in between. That kind of work sharpens you fast. It taught me to see light differently, to anticipate rather than react, and to disappear into a room while still catching everything in it.

I stepped back from professional photography in 2020 to focus on other things, but the eye never really turns off. Everything since — the travel shots, the candids, the gallery below — is downstream of those twelve years behind the camera at someone else’s most important day.
